- Businesses purchasing passenger cars for personal use cannot deduct the input tax paid from the output tax
- An example was given of a company that falsely reported input tax on a purchased car, resulting in a penalty
- Businesses should report any instances of not being able to deduct input tax before being investigated to avoid penalties
- People with questions can contact the tax office for assistance
